Making a Surface full of Pores

Pottery pots often have surfaces which are full of pores. We show you a professional trick how to paint them with acrylics in a very realistic way: First, you have to produce a watery colour mixing consisting of burnt umber and light ochre. The colour mixing has to be watery enough to start foaming after being dabbed on with a bristle brush.

Once the colourful foam has dried, only some ‚foam blisters‘ will remain, looking like little colourful dots. The result is going to seem like tiny pores.
